Really have searched and haven't found an answer to this one....We received Classic Package when booked, my husband does not drink alcohol. Will it be possible to switch him to premium non alcohol package pre cruise, or on ship?

Probably too complicated for Celebrity to do pre-cruise.:rolleyes: Ask on the ship (at check-in, Guest Relations or a Bar) and see if they will just put a PNAL sticker on your card over the CAL stamp that he will have on his card. If they will not do so, ask how much to upgrade, though there shouldn't be a cost in my opinion as long as he is not drinking alcohol.

Just came back from a 10 night cruise on Equinox. We had the Classic Package included. My husband does not drink. We went to Guest Relations the first day and they changed his to Premium Nonalcoholic Package for no cost. He was therefore able to drink the premium waters and such. They gave him a new sea pass with the package on it. Very easy to do! Enjoy!
